Price summary

A used Jeep Wrangler ac compressor (3.6L, 48 volt system (eTorque)) costs $50 to $444, with a median asking price of $164. Based on 273 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Aug 21,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

Trim-specific context

How is the 3.6L, 48 volt system (eTorque) priced differently?

This pricing covers the 3.6L, 48 volt system (eTorque) variant of the Jeep Wrangler ac compressor, based on 273 priced listings across 6 model years (2020, 2021, 2022, 2023, 2024, 2025). Its $164 median is 6% below the Jeep Wrangler ac compressor overall median of $175.

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
